Why “centzontle” is a great word
CENTZONTLE — [Noun] A mockingbird, especially one native to the Americas, famed for its ability to mimic a vast repertoire of sounds. Borrowed from Spanish 'cenzontle', from Classical Nahuatl 'centzontleh', a shortened form of 'centzontlahtōleh' ("mockingbird", literally "possessor of four hundred words"), from 'centzontli' ("four hundred") + 'tlahtōlli' ("language, word") + '-eh' ("possessor of"). Unlike "nightingale"—which evokes a singular, lyrical Old World thrush—or the generic "mimic," the *centzontle* is a precise New World virtuoso, its identity bound to the poetic quantification of its indigenous name. Etymology
Borrowed from Spanish cenzontle, from Classical Nahuatl centzontleh, shortened form of centzontlahtōleh (“mockingbird”, literally “possessor of four hundred words”), from centzontli (“four hundred, a count of four hundred”) + tlahtōlli (“language, word, statement”) + -eh (“possessor of”).
